Overview
About MDO-2000A
The GW Instek MDO-2000A is a mixed-domain oscilloscope that integrates a full spectrum analyzer alongside time-domain oscilloscope channels in a single instrument. Available in 100 MHz, 200 MHz, and 300 MHz bandwidth options with 2 or 4 analog channels, the MDO-2000A captures time-domain waveforms and frequency-domain spectra simultaneously, enabling engineers to correlate time and frequency events during EMI debugging, RF circuit validation, and switching power supply analysis.
The built-in spectrum analyzer covers DC to 1 GHz, providing frequency-domain visibility without requiring a separate bench instrument. This is particularly valuable for embedded systems work where clock harmonics, switching noise, and unintentional RF emissions need to be identified and correlated with specific circuit activity on the time-domain channels.
MDO-2000A Specifications
| Feature | Specification |
|---|---|
| Bandwidth | 100 / 200 / 300 MHz |
| Analog Channels | 2 or 4 |
| Sampling Rate | 1 GSa/s (2-ch), 500 MSa/s (4-ch) |
| Memory Depth | 10 Mpts per channel |
| Spectrum Analyzer | Built-in, DC to 1 GHz |
| SA Resolution BW | 1 Hz to 1 MHz |
| Serial Decode | I2C, SPI, UART, CAN, LIN |
| Built-in AWG | Dual-channel, 25 MHz |
| Waveform Update | 120,000 wfm/s (VPO) |
| Display | 8-inch WVGA LCD |
A dual-channel 25 MHz arbitrary waveform generator, serial bus decoding (I2C, SPI, UART, CAN, LIN), and VPO (Visual Persistence Oscilloscope) waveform technology with 120,000 wfm/s update rate round out the MDO-2000A’s capabilities. The instrument is well suited for R&D engineers and test labs that work across time and frequency domains, debugging switching converters, characterizing clock jitter, or identifying EMI sources, without dedicating bench space and budget to separate oscilloscope and spectrum analyzer instruments.
